javascript - 如何设置 javascript 重定向以将用户发送到后台页面?看代码

标签 javascript jquery

使用 onclick="history.go(-1);return false;" 用户可以导航到后页。但是如果我想在将用户带到后面之前放置一个确认方法。我该怎么做?

我认为可以通过执行如下操作来实现,但我不确定如何将用户重定向到后台页面?

$('.clickme').click(function() {
    if(confirm("Are you sure you want to navigate away from this page?"))
    {
      //window.close();
      // how to redirect to history.go(-1) ??
    }        
    return false;
 });

更新

还有什么方法可以检查历史记录中是否有某些值还是为空?这样我就可以提醒用户如果为空?

最佳答案

正如您想象的那样简单:

$('.clickme').click(function() {
   if(confirm("Are you sure you want to navigate away from this page?"))
   {
      history.go(-1);
   }        
   return false;
});

关于javascript - 如何设置 javascript 重定向以将用户发送到后台页面?看代码,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/2326449/

相关文章:

javascript - 如果没有 jQuery,我怎样才能重写这段代码呢?

javascript - 查询数组javascript

javascript - JavaScript 中单竖线和双竖线(|、||)的区别?

javascript - Chart.js 最大图例高度

javascript - 使用 ajax 和 select2 设置数据属性

javascript - 将值从模态传递到主窗体

jquery - 在表格行前面添加向下滑动

javascript - 如果给出了国家名称,则自动归档城市名称

javascript - Stormpath 自定义数据

PHP/Javascript共享压缩库